Abstract
Due to the radial refractive index gradients that sometimes develop in flow cells during the travelling of the samples through them, the absorbance records obtained in such conditions have a strange shape, particularly at low analyte levels. To correct this phenomenon, called Schlieren effect, a simple and reliable signal processing algorithm is described in correlation to the detector characteristics of noise. The algorithm is illustrated in nitrite and nitrate determinations with proflavin from more real samples. It has a solid theoretical support and involves the subtraction from the sample records of a smoothed signal, acquired by working with a blank solution.
